Proposal
Variation of condition 2 (Approved Plans) attached to planning permission 20/06423/VCDN relating to variations to the original permission 18/06767/FUL (Change of use of land to site 40 residential park homes with associated car parking, landscaping, recreational areas and boundary fence and gate (all within area outlined in orange on plan 07B707320-001 Rev N), siting of ranger's lodge unit with new access onto Bassetsbury Lane on land adjoining the proposed park home estate (within area outlined in blue on plan 07B707320-001 Rev L).) to allow for the repositioning of parking spaces and minor amendments to the approved site layout
